A Third of Wills Include Trusts β Should Yours?
While trusts are often thought of as something only used for complex tax planning, they're a common feature of many everyday Wills because they offer practical protection for the people who matter most.
A trust allows the people you appoint as trustees to look after certain assets on behalf of your beneficiaries, following the wishes you've set out in your Will. This can provide valuable flexibility and peace of mind for the future.

What Happens to a Lasting Power of Attorney When Someone Dies?
A Lasting Power of Attorney (LPA) automatically comes to an end when the person who made it dies.
From that point, the attorney no longer has the legal authority to make decisions, manage bank accounts or deal with the person's financial or personal affairs.
Responsibility for administering the estate then passes to the Executors named in the Will, or, if there is no Will, to the estate's administrators.
Understanding when an LPA ends can help avoid confusion at an already difficult time. If you're unsure about what happens next, we're here to provide clear, practical guidance.
